Analysis
Brunei Darussalam recorded 0.6566 UIS estimate for mobile outbound gross enrolment ratio, tertiary students studying in in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 8.2% on the previous year and down 52.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, mobile outbound gross enrolment ratio, tertiary students studying in in Brunei Darussalam peaked at 1.42 UIS estimate in 2015 and was at its lowest, 0.607 UIS estimate, in 2022.
Brunei Darussalam ranks 142nd of 205 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 11 years of available data.
Mobile outbound gross enrolment ratio, tertiary students studying in in Brunei Darussalam, year by year
| Year | UIS estimate |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2013 | 1.37 UIS estimate | — |
| 2014 | 1.39 UIS estimate | +1.0% |
| 2015 | 1.42 UIS estimate | +2.7% |
| 2016 | 1.34 UIS estimate | -6.2% |
| 2017 | 1.32 UIS estimate | -1.2% |
| 2018 | 1.32 UIS estimate | +0.1% |
| 2019 | 1.38 UIS estimate | +4.5% |
| 2020 | 1.29 UIS estimate | -6.8% |
| 2021 | 0.9076 UIS estimate | -29.4% |
| 2022 | 0.607 UIS estimate | -33.1% |
| 2023 | 0.6566 UIS estimate | +8.2% |
